Output 17c5062406e038efc7a774f7f4da40c7b6f4756d4d0889e4f12e04a6470efd04:9

value
5950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3438648757b878835b476d2028777ef99d910063 OP_EQUAL
address
36T8ckZ74YDLdGDPz8ZUxnkHRhVcxA77RT
transaction
17c5062406e038efc7a774f7f4da40c7b6f4756d4d0889e4f12e04a6470efd04
spent
true